WebMar 27, 2024 · 5-HTP is an amino acid produced by the human body from the essential amino acid L-tryptophan, which must be obtained through your diet. L-tryptophan can be found in foods like seeds, soybeans, turkey, and cheese. Enzymes naturally convert L-tryptophan into 5-HTP and then convert 5-HTP into 5-HT. Web5-hydroxytryptophan (5-HTP) is a chemical that the body makes from tryptophan (an essential amino acid that you get from food). After tryptophan is converted into 5-HTP, the chemical is changed into another chemical called serotonin (a neurotransmitter that relays signals between brain cells). 5-HTP dietary supplements help raise serotonin levels in the …

WebAug 30, 2014 · Cod. Sardines. Beans. Eggs. Pumpkin seeds. Wheat germ. Tryptophan converts to serotonin with the help of other nutrients, most notably vitamin B-6. Vitamin B-6 is also present in the foods that contain tryptophan. Tryptophan competes with other amino acids in protein-rich foods fighting for entry into the brain. Tryptophan absorption into the brain is influenced by diet. A high carbohydrate, low protein diet will release insulin, which ultimately increases the absorption of tryptophan into the brain and can, therefore, increase serotonin.
